Baffled Interior Network to Prevent Fuel Starvation

An internal chamber design breaks the tank volume into isolated zones that drastically limit slosh during hard cornering, acceleration or sudden braking. This layout keeps the pickup port submerged at all times, avoiding interruptions in supply that can produce lean spikes during high load events. Consistent fuel delivery supports precise injector metering, which is vital for engines tuned north of 550 horsepower and for setups running forced induction. By controlling fluid motion, the baffle network also reduces turbulence around the pump inlet, helping preserve the module and maintain stable pressure under all operating angles. The outcome is a reliable air fuel ratio that delivers crisp throttle response and prevents damage from dry runs.
